We all know that trees are alive. But what if there was a way to tell a tree’s story?
When Alfie’s grandpa reveals that paper, if made correctly, can tell the story of the tree it came from, Alfie isn’t sure whether to believe him.
Once he starts paying attention, he realises that he is the only one listening to the trees. He must spring into action to save the trees from being chopped down and to protect all the animals that live there.
Told using actors, puppets, shadows, and storytelling, The Truth About Trees is a heartwarming story about nature, stories and standing up for what you believe in.
This play was developed through working with schools and young audiences in Aberdeenshire. They helped us to explore what a tree might feel over the hundreds of years that it’s alive as well as the impact that nature has on the lives of people who live nearby.
